What Is The Cost For A Hillview Camp?

Hillview camps are funded through free will offerings by people in local churches who wish to support it. There is therefore no set charge for people participating. Donations may be made to the following account:

Hillview Bible Studies, BSB 082-707, Acct No. 812918052.

Do I Need To Bring Food?

Usually at camps run by us we provide all meals. Please advise on the registration form if you have special dietary requirements.

If you are attending a camp on Hillview run by your own church, you will need to follow their instructions concerning food.

What Are The Accomodation Options?

We have a limited number of cabins available for campers. You will need to register for these. Alternatively, many choose to bring their own tent or caravan. Campers use a shared toilet and shower block.

What Sort Of Church Runs Hillview Camps?

Hillview camps are predominantly run by people who belong to the Christian Community Churches of Australia network of churches. This is a network which holds to mainstream Christian teachings- see details about this network here.

Hillview has always welcomed people from a wide variety of church backgrounds to attend. All are welcome.
